Wemyss Bay train station is well-equipped to accommodate your travel needs. The ticket office is open from early morning till late in the evening, from 6:10 AM to 11:20 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:55 AM to 9:30 PM on Sundays. You can also purchase tickets from the machines conveniently placed at the station.
For those who booked tickets online, collection is a breeze with accessible machines available (note: accessibility features are limited for ticket machines). The station is also fitted with an induction loop to assist visitors with hearing impairments. However, Smartcards aren't issued at this station.
Need help? Assistance is readily available through the help point or at the ticket office. Wemyss Bay prides itself on being an inclusive station, rated as a Category A for accessibility, offering step-free access throughout, including a ramp for train access and accessible toilets. Staff assistance is available throughout most of the day—just head over to the Passenger Assist meeting point at the ticket office.
Comfort isn't compromised at Wemyss Bay. The station offers waiting rooms with seating areas should you need a respite while on your travels. While there are no lounges or currency exchange services, you can find a charming book shop and a bar to cater to your needs. And yes, public Wi-Fi is available to help you stay connected on the go.
Despite its idyllic setting, Wemyss Bay station isn't isolated. Buses operate from and to the station on Shore Road. Check details on TravelLine Scotland or by calling 0871 200 22 33. Taxis are available for hire through TrainTaxi, offering you numerous travel options.

Alton Station boasts a variety of fac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and pleasant.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 19:00 on weekdays, with differing hours over the weekend, including Sundays from 08:30 to 16:00. Complementing the ticket office are ticket machines located conveniently in the station, accessible for all passengers, including those with disabilities.
For added convenience, the station is equipped with step-free access throughout its premises, including lifts to the platforms, ensuring everyone can navigate with ease. While the absence of a dedicated waiting room may seem a drawback, ample seating is available. Furthermore, passengers can enjoy refreshments from the on-site Whistle Stop Agents or café, making waits more bearable with some delicious fare.
Alton Station takes pride in being accessible to all. Accessibility features include accessible ticket machines, ramps for train access, and CCTV for added security. There are help points available for passengers in need of assistance, aligning with the station’s welcoming disposition. For more personalized help, staff are present during most operating hours, ensuring that anyone who requires aid during travel will be well taken care of.
